In the post after the one I Replied to, with content by Andrew F. Branca (the MA lawyer), he reminds those who don't know that Florida has a self-defense law that is separate from its 2005 “Stand Your Ground” "self-defense law". That post has a link to each one.

The Zimmerman defense did not use “Stand Your Ground” AFAIK.
